About James Robert Keller

James Robert Keller is a lawyer practicing construction law, alternative dispute resolution, litigation and appeals and 1 other area of law. James received a B.J. degree from University of Missouri, and has been licensed for 46 years. James practices at Herzog Crebs LLP in St. Louis, MO.
